Why drains in Alexandria behave the way they do

Plumbing issues adhere to the age of the area. In pre-war homes near King Street, initial actors iron can be harsh inside, like sandpaper to grease and dust. Those pipes were meant for a various era of soaps and water use. In time, interior scaling tightens the diameter, and all caked fat or coffee ground has even more areas to catch. Farther west toward Seminary Roadway and Beauregard, post-war residential or commercial properties usually have a mix of materials, with clay or Orangeburg sewage system laterals that have lived past their convenience zone. Clay sections change at joints and invite hairline origin breach. The origins flourish where yard watering and foundation plantings maintain the soil damp.

On top of materials and age, Alexandria sees broad swings between saturating tornados and dry spells. After heavy rain, sump pumps push more water toward primary lines, and any type of weakness in a drain ends up being noticeable. Throughout cold snaps, oil in cooking area runs becomes a waxy cork. The city's slim streets and shared easements complicate accessibility. A specialist drain cleaning service that functions here on a regular basis learns to stage equipment with minimal impact, coordinate with neighbors for cleanout access, and prepare for the old-house peculiarities that do not show up in a textbook.

What a proficient drain cleaning go to actually looks like

A typical solution telephone call should begin with a discussion and a quick study. You are not a ticket number, and every minute of history assists. If the bathroom sink in the upstairs hall has actually been slow for a year and the kitchen area supported recently, those realities indicate divide troubles. One is likely a regional obstruction in the catch arm or vertical pile. The various other might be an oil choke in the straight cooking area run or a partial obstruction generally. A technology that pays attention can save you both time and money.

After the walk-through, the job divides into accessibility, medical diagnosis, and removal. Accessibility depends upon the component and where the blockage is, yet cleanouts are the very best beginning factor. If a property does not have functional cleanouts, it might require pulling a commode or removing a catch. For medical diagnosis, specialists depend on two devices as a baseline: a cord device and an electronic camera. The cable determines whether the line is openable. The cam shows why it got obstructed and whether the piping itself is sound.

Cable work has its own finesse. On a kitchen line, cable selection issues due to the fact that soft cords penetrate via oil and afterwards "cork-screw" it without scratching a clean path. A stiffer cable with a correctly sized blade tends to cut rather than poke openings, which suggests the line remains clear much longer. In actors iron, oscillating and incremental ahead pressure stays clear of gouging hydro jetting experts a currently slim wall. In clay laterals with roots, you do not wish to ram the cable so hard that it expands a joint. The objective is controlled reducing, not brute force.

Once circulation is brought back, the video camera levels. I have actually found offsets that just obstruct when a washing equipment discharges at full rate, and bellies that hold simply enough water to catch paper for weeks. Without a camera, you may believe the obstruction is arbitrary and support for the next one. With video, you know whether you require a repair service, a hydro jetting service, or simply better habits.

Clogged drain repair work, crafted for the specific problem

Clogged drains pipes are not a solitary category. Hair in a bathtub waste requires a different touch than lint snared around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Basic hair clogs reply to hands-on removal and a brief wire run. If the tub has an old trip-lever setting up with a corroded spring, that mechanism might be the actual trouble, catching hair like a rake. Changing the setting up while the line is open avoids the repeat call.

Kitchen sinks are the battle zone. Modern dish soaps reduced oil far better than they utilized to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still glue themselves to the pipe wall surfaces. Do it yourself enzyme products have their place for upkeep, however they can not dig deep into solidified fats that have actually cooled and layered. On a grease line, a two-step strategy functions best: mechanical cutting to reclaim flow, then a regulated warm water flush to rinse put on hold fats downstream. If the grease extends right into the main, or if the build-up is hefty and layered, hydro jetting comes to be a smarter choice than duplicated cabling.

Toilets provide their very own challenges. A single obstruction after an ill-advised flush of wipes is something. Repeated clogs indicate a catch style problem, an underpowered flush, or a partial obstruction beyond the closet bend. I have actually discovered toy dinosaurs wedged past the trap, unknown to the homeowner, that just triggered troubles when paper stuck behind them. An electronic camera with a small head can slide past the bathroom flange after pulling the component, and that five-minute look can conserve you changing an entire bathroom that is blameless.

Basement floor drains pipes and washing standpipes typically mislead. When both back-up, lots of people assume the major sewer is blocked. Often that is true. Various other times a check valve has actually fallen short,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washer that discards a rise. A serious drain cleaning service tests components individually, enjoys circulations, and associates the timing of back-ups. If the line holds throughout low-flow components but burps throughout a washing machine cycle, capacity, not absolute clog, is your villain.

When hydro jetting is the ideal move

Hydro jetting uses high-pressure water, generally in between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, provided with a pipe with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ts grease and searches the pipe wall surface, and the rear jets draw the pipe onward while flushing debris back to the cleanout. For heavy grease and layered scale, it is extra efficient than cabling because it cleanses the full circumference of the pipe.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ens the line a lot more evenly than a spiral blade that can leave hairs to catch paper.

Jetting brings its own regulations. Pipeline problem dictates stress and nozzle option. In fragile actors iron with obvious thinning, make use of reduced stress and a spinning nozzle that brightens rather than knives. In newer PVC, greater stress with a warthog or comparable nozzle clears sludge fast without danger. A knowledgeable technology evaluates exactly how quickly the line is removing by the feel of the hose, the sound of return water, and the debris leaving the cleanout. If sand or accumulation puts out, you could be handling a broken pipe or a flattened area, and every minute of jetting should be balanced against the threat of cleaning extra bed linen away.

The finest usage situation for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the major drain with scale and paper problems, and business lines that see continuous food waste. Dining local sewer cleaning Establishments on Mount Vernon Opportunity understand the rhythm: quarterly jetting maintains service undisturbed. For a homeowner with reoccuring kitchen sink backups every three months, a solitary jetting usually resets the clock for a year or more, supplied the line is sound and the family avoids dumping oil down the drain.

Sewer cleaning that respects the line and the property

Sewer cleaning is about bring back flow, yet that does not indicate giving up the lawn or the pathway. Alexandria's narrow lots commonly hide the drain lateral under garden beds and rock pathways. A thoughtful sewer cleaning company phases tubes and machines to shield growings and stays clear of unneeded excavation. Start with every easily accessible cleanout. If the home does not have one near the front, it may be worth installing a brand-new cleanout at the property line. That single enhancement can transform a half-day battle into a one-hour upkeep job.

Cabling a sewer should be a measured process. If origins exist, a series of progressively larger blades is much better than leaping to the maximum size and chewing the joint right into an irregular birthed. Camera inspection after the first pass tells you where the roots are going into. Several Alexandria laterals have a brief clay section from your house to the walkway, after that a PVC replacement to the city main. The transition is where origins attack. As soon as you know the exact area, you can reduce cleanly and talk about whether a spot repair, liner, or proceeded upkeep makes sense.

Grease in a drain is much less typical for single-family homes, but multi-unit buildings and homes with cellar kitchen areas see it more. Jetting excels here, with a final pass of warm water to bring the slurry downstream. If multiple devices contribute to the line, the schedule matters as high as the technique. Collaborating a building-wide kitchen time out during the service protects against fresh discharge from moving oil into a freshly cleaned segment.

The mathematics behind "rooter currently, repair later"

Not every issue warrants instant substitute. I bring a collection of examples in my head from work where persistence and maintenance worked far better than a rush to dig. A home owner on a tree-lined street had origins at a solitary joint, 6 feet from the visual. We cut them clean, jetted the line, and saw a slight offset on camera without much dirt visible. Rather than trench a stone sidewalk and interrupt the well established boxwoods, we set up origin reducing every 12 to 18 months and fed a little dosage of root control foam after the spring growth flush. That was 8 years earlier. The sidewalk is intact, and complete upkeep expenses still sit listed below the price of excavation by a large margin.

On the various other hand, I have actually seen stomaches that hold 2 inches of water over a lengthy stretch. Cam video footage shows paper sitting in the dip, moving just with heavy circulations. In those cases, no quantity of jetting changes the geometry. You can preserve around a stomach, yet you will deal with routine stagnations and stricter regulations about what decreases. If the tummy rests under a driveway slated for resurfacing, coordinate the repair service with the paving. You only want to dig deep into once.

Practical habits that decrease obstructions without babying the system

Some routines carry more weight than others. Garbage disposals are not the villains they are constructed to be, but they can be abused. Coffee grounds are great in percentages if purged with great deals of water, however they come to be mortar when blended with oil. Rice and pasta swell and adhesive to sludge. Wipes labeled "flushable" disperse slowly and tangle in harsh pipeline walls. Soap scum in older tubs is much more concerning water chemistry and low-flow components than anything else. Washing hair catchers and periodic enzyme maintenance help maintain those lines honest.

A well-timed hot water flush after greasy cooking evenings makes a distinction. Run the faucet on warm for a min after dishwashing. It does not dissolve old grease, yet it pushes soft deposits out of the catch arm and into larger size pipeline where they are much less most likely to stick. For washing, spacing loads stops a rise that bewilders marginal standpipes. If your electronic camera revealed a tummy, that spacing is not optional.

Hydro jetting, cabling, or fixing: how to choose

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with pressure, and repair service as the reconstruction. Cabling is precise for tough blockages, origins, and localized blockages.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leaning, oil, sludge, and range. Repair work or lining solves geometry issues, broken sectors, and significant intrusions.

If your major has a single root intrusion at a joint and the pipeline is or else strong, cabling followed by root-specific jetting provides you tidy wall surfaces and a much longer interval in between sees. If your cooking area line is slow-moving on a monthly basis and the electronic camera complete drain cleaning service shows heavy grease lengthwise, jetting deserves the financial investment. If the electronic camera shows a collapse, a deep belly, or a major balanced out, miss repeated cleansing and cost the repair work. In Alexandria, numerous laterals are superficial near your home and deeper near the visual. Situating the problem might expose a repair work just three feet deep close to the front actions,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real examples from Alexandria blocks

On a row of 1920s brick homes near Braddock Roadway, three neighbors called within 2 months with the very same issue: slow-moving first-floor toilets, gurgling tub drains, and occasional cellar floor drain moisture after tornados. The shared aspect was a clay segment just before the city major, invaded by roots. Each home had a different design, however the electronic camera told the very same story. The first property owner chose semiannual origin cutting. The second chose hydro jetting plus a foam origin treatment. The third scheduled a place repair work before a prepared outdoor patio improvement. A year later on, all three continued to be happy, each with an option matched to their budget and tolerance for persisting maintenance.

In a split-level west of Fort Ward, a household struggled with a cooking area line that clogged every 6 weeks. The run took a trip with an ended up ceiling and turned two times previously dropping to the main. Cord local drain cleaning Alexandria passes opened flow, yet oil returned promptly. We jetted the line with a small spinning nozzle at modest pressure, after that purged with warm water and degreaser. The camera revealed a tidy, brilliant inside. We relocated the air admittance valve to boost airing vent, which minimized the sink's sluggishness. With nothing else transformed, they went eighteen months prior to the following solution telephone call, which one was for a lavatory sink trap, not the kitchen.

What you can do today before calling

If a solitary component is slow-moving, clear the catch and check the air vent. Often a bird nest or a leaf floor covering on a flat roof air vent creates adverse stress that mimics a blockage. For a persistent kitchen area sink that is still draining pipes slowly, a long, consistent warm water run can press soft oil past a sticky area. Prevent putting chemicals into the drainpipe. They can shed a tech throughout solution, and they rarely touch the real blockage. If several fixtures at the most affordable level are supporting, stop using water and call for sewer cleaning. Continuing to run water risks flooding and damage, and any added discharge will pressurize the blockage.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

Does pouring hot water down a drain unclog it?

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
